Wrist Injury Recovery

  • The podcast discusses wrist injury recovery, including acute trauma and repetitive motion disorders.
  • Patients with prolonged or progressive wrist pain, restricted movement, popping sounds, reduced grip, and reduced forearm movement may have a TFCC injury that can be shown on MRI imaging.
  • Acupuncture and physical therapy together can help mild to moderate cases of wrist injuries recover mobility and reduce pain.
  • To recover from wrist pain, it is important to eliminate the causes and use treatment protocols such as hot/cold compress, self-massage, physical therapy, liniments, and acupuncture.

Acupuncture for Wrist Injury Recovery

  • Acupuncture has been shown to improve or completely recover conditions resulting in carpal tunnel syndrome and triangular fibrocartilage complex (TFCC) injuries.

  • Carpal tunnel injuries to the median nerve can affect wrist mobility and cause pain.
  • Paracardium 7, Daling is the key point for treating carpal tunnel syndrome.
  • Acupuncturists will often add support points like triple burn of five, heart seven, pericardium six, large intestine five, long nine.
  • Stimulation of the median nerve enhances blood flow and has a powerful anti-inflammatory effect.

Other Factors Contributing to Wrist Pain

  • Wrist pain can be caused by various factors, including poor ergonomics or sleeping positions.
  • Treatment time varies depending on the severity of injury and any complications like diabetes that slow healing.
